How to overcome VBA ms.word-replace-macro 255 limitation?

0

Hi all, I’ve been searching for a solution for this problem for days. I’m not using the vba replace function instead I’m using the word replace macro. Problem is this macro will not accept text exceeding 255 characters. Note: Line 6 where value inserted to “replacement.text” assigned to “replacement_” And error occurs in this scenario. Is there a way to insert more than 255 characters using the ms.word- replace macro below? I need to use the ms.word-replace macro below, because it can insert the data in right places in the document. Please help me on this, thanks!
